Subject: cdc_ncm: Fix tx_bytes statistics
MIME-Version: 1.0
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8
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it
Origin: https://git.kernel.org/linus/44f6731d8b68fa02f5ed65eaceac41f8c3c9279e
The tx_curr_frame_payload field is u32. When we try to calculate a
small negative delta based on it, we end up with a positive integer
close to 2^32 instead. So the tx_bytes pointer increases by about
2^32 for every transmitted frame.
Fix by calculating the delta as a signed long.

Subject: config: Enable NEED_DMA_MAP_STATE by default when SWIOTLB is selected
Origin: https://git.kernel.org/linus/a6dfa128ce5c414ab46b1d690f7a1b8decb8526d
Bug-Debian: https://bugs.debian.org/786551
A huge amount of NIC drivers use the DMA API, however if
compiled under 32-bit an very important part of the DMA API can
be ommitted leading to the drivers not working at all
(especially if used with 'swiotlb=force iommu=soft').
As Prashant Sreedharan explains it: "the driver [tg3] uses
DEFINE_DMA_UNMAP_ADDR(), dma_unmap_addr_set() to keep a copy of
the dma "mapping" and dma_unmap_addr() to get the "mapping"
value. On most of the platforms this is a no-op, but ... with
"iommu=soft and swiotlb=force" this house keeping is required,
... otherwise we pass 0 while calling pci_unmap_/pci_dma_sync_
instead of the DMA address."
As such enable this even when using 32-bit kernels.
